Gu, Xiangli; Thomas, Katherine Thomas; Chen, Yu-Lin – Journal of Teaching in Physical Education, 2017
Purpose: Guided by Stodden et al.'s (2008) conceptual model, the purpose of this study was to examine the associations among perceived competence, actual motor competence (MC), physical activity (PA), and cardiorespiratory fitness in elementary children. The group differences were also investigated as a function of MC levels. Methods: A…
